Patent-protected methylone-inspired analogs support pipeline expansion into PTSD Enveric Biosciences (NASDAQ:ENVB) ("Enveric" or the "Company"), a biotechnology company advancing novel neuroplastogenic small-molecule therapeutics to address psychiatric and neurological disorders, today announced a second Notice of Allowance from the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) for novel compounds within its EVM401 Series, expanding its intellectual property assets in the treatment of mental health disorders. EB-003 significantly decreased context-induced freezing behavior one-hour post-dose (p < 0.05) indicating a positive therapeutic effect in well-established translational rodent model for PTSD Enveric Biosciences (NASDAQ:ENVB) ("Enveric" or the "Company"), a biotechnology company dedicated to the development of novel neuroplastogenic small-molecule therapeutics for the treatment of psychiatric and neurological disorders, today announced positive results in a preclinical, exposure-based therapeutic model for post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). 30+ year pharmaceutical industry veteran joins Enveric's executive team to lead company's financial and capital markets activities. Enveric Biosciences (NASDAQ:ENVB) ("Enveric" or the "Company"), a biotechnology company dedicated to the development of novel small-molecule therapeutics for the treatment of anxiety, depression, and addiction disorders, announced today the appointment of Kevin Coveney, CPA, to the position of Chief Financial Officer, effective March 13, 2023. Mr. Coveney brings 30+ years of accounting, finance, and operations experience to Enveric, having previously served as Chief Financial Officer for multiple biotechnology companies.
